Ensuring RG4 Installation for Maximum Signal Integrity

Achieving optimal signal integrity in RG4 installations necessitates careful consideration of several factors during the installation process. In order to achieve this, it is crucial to select high-quality RG4 website cable with low attenuation and minimal impedance variations. Additionally, proper termination techniques are essential for minimizing signal reflections and ensuring a clean transmission path. Pay close attention factors such as connector type, crimping technique, and shielding effectiveness to minimize the impact of electromagnetic interference (EMI).

  • Utilizing proper grounding techniques can substantially improve signal integrity by eliminating ground loops and noise coupling.
  • Laying out RG4 cable away from sources of electromagnetic interference, such as power lines and motors, can also minimize signal degradation.
  • Periodically inspecting RG4 installations for signs of damage or deterioration is essential to ensure long-term signal integrity.

Troubleshooting Common Issues with RG4 Cable Connections

When connecting your devices with an RG4 cable, you might encounter some problems. Don't worry! These issues are often easily fixed.

Here are a few common RG4 cable connection problems and why to fix them:

* **Loose Connections:** A loose connection is a typical culprit.

Ensure the connectors are firmly plugged into both the gadget.

* **Damaged Cable:** Inspect the cable for visible wear and tear, such as breaks. A damaged cable needs to be swapped for a new one.

* **Signal Interference:** Other signals can interfere the RG4 signal. Try repositioning your gadgets to minimize interference.

* **Incompatible Connectors:** Check that both the gadget and the cable have compatible connectors.

Keep in mind that if you've attempted these troubleshooting solutions and are still encountering problems, it's best to consult a qualified expert.
